Orioles Keys to the Game vs. the Astros
The Orioles are just 3-6 (.333) when tied entering the 7th inning this season — tied for 5th lowest in MLB; League Avg: .500.
The Orioles are just 10-41 (.196) when scoring 4 or fewer runs this season — 4th lowest in MLB; League Avg: .275.

Astros Keys to the Game vs. the Orioles
The Astros are just 19-28 (.404) after a win this season — 3rd lowest in MLB; League Avg: .517.
The Astros are 8-3 (.727) when tied entering the 8th inning this season — tied for best in MLB; League Avg: .500.
The Astros are 41-0 (1.000) when leading entering the 9th inning this season — tied for best in MLB; League Avg: .947.
The Astros are 35-2 (.946) when leading entering the 7th inning this season — 3rd best in MLB; League Avg: .866.
Orioles Hitting Stats & Trends
Orioles hitters have struck out in 25% of their PA’s against LHP this season — tied for 4th highest in MLB.
Orioles hitters are slugging just .179 on pitches out of the zone this season — 2nd lowest in MLB.
The Orioles are batting just .131 on pitches out of the zone this season — 2nd lowest in MLB.
The Orioles are batting just .153 with two-strikes this season — 2nd lowest in MLB.
Astros Hitting Stats & Trends
Astros hitters have struck out in just 20% of their PA’s against LHP this season — 5th best in MLB.
The Astros are batting just .232 at home this season — 5th lowest in MLB.
The Astros have scored 197 runs with two outs this season — most in MLB.
Astros hitters have an OBP of just .306 (1,715 PA’s) at home this season — 4th lowest in MLB.
Orioles Pitching Stats & Trends
Orioles pitchers have an ERA of 5.41 (228.0 IP) against division opponents this season — 3rd highest in MLB.
The Orioles pitchers have allowed their opponents to score first in 55% of their games on the road this season — 4th highest in MLB.
Orioles pitchers have a strikeout rate of just 20% in the first 5 innings this season — tied for 4th lowest in MLB.
Orioles pitchers are throwing just 3.82 pitches per plate appearance this season — tied for 5th lowest in MLB.
Astros Pitching Stats & Trends
Astros pitchers have walked 12% of batters when facing the leadoff batter in the inning this season — highest in MLB.
Astros pitchers have walked 11% of batters this season — tied for 2nd highest in MLB.
Opponents have a groundball rate of just 39% against Astros pitchers this season — 2nd lowest in MLB.
Astros pitchers have an ERA of 4.77 (426.0 IP) at home this season — 4th highest in MLB.
